春运火车票已累计发售超5100万张

Core Viewpoint - The railway department has successfully sold 51.02 million tickets for the Spring Festival travel rush as of January 31, indicating strong passenger demand and effective operation of the railway ticketing system [1] Group 1: Ticket Sales and Demand - As of January 31, 2023, the railway department has sold a total of 51.02 million Spring Festival tickets since sales began on January 19 [1] - The ticket sales for February 14 (Lunar New Year’s Eve) started on January 31, with high demand for travel to major cities such as Guangzhou, Beijing, Shanghai, and Shenzhen [1] Group 2: Pricing Strategy - The railway department is implementing a market-oriented pricing mechanism during the Spring Festival, offering flexible and differentiated ticket pricing based on date, time, and route [2] - Discounts for non-popular routes can reach up to 80%, with specific examples including a 20% discount on hard seat tickets from Zhengzhou to Guangzhou and significant discounts on other routes [2] Group 3: Capacity Management - The railway department is utilizing big data from the 12306 platform to analyze passenger demand in real-time and adjust ticket availability accordingly [2] - To address potential congestion in popular areas, the department plans to increase train services and allocate additional tickets to meet demand, prioritizing those who have submitted waiting list orders [2]
